Contact forces: types of forces that result when the two interacting objects are apparent to be physically linking each other.
Ex: frictional forces, tensional forces, normal forces, air resistant forces, applied forces.

The energy needed to ionize an atom is known as ionization energy. It is the energy needed to make the electron jump from the present orbit to the infinite orbit.
Because force=dp/dt and force=0 in first law of motion => dp/dt=0 => p=const. or linear momentum is conserved.
